From f82846c1a94cae9ae21524a857414caee1511fb3 Mon Sep 17 00:00:00 2001
From: admin <weikou2014>
Date: 星期四, 01 八月 2019 10:26:47 +0800
Subject: [PATCH] 订单爬取修改

---
 fanli/src/main/java/com/yeshi/fanli/util/jd/JDApiUtil.java |   10 ++--------
 1 files changed, 2 insertions(+), 8 deletions(-)

diff --git a/fanli/src/main/java/com/yeshi/fanli/util/jd/JDApiUtil.java b/fanli/src/main/java/com/yeshi/fanli/util/jd/JDApiUtil.java
index a1042a3..8d6b472 100644
--- a/fanli/src/main/java/com/yeshi/fanli/util/jd/JDApiUtil.java
+++ b/fanli/src/main/java/com/yeshi/fanli/util/jd/JDApiUtil.java
@@ -645,18 +645,12 @@
 
 		json.put("orderReq", orderReq);
 		String result = baseRequest2("jd.union.open.order.query", null, json);
-		try {
-			System.out.println(new String(result.getBytes("GBK"), "UTF-8"));
-			System.out.println(new String(result.getBytes("ISO-8859-1"), "UTF-8"));
-		} catch (UnsupportedEncodingException e) {
-			e.printStackTrace();
-		}
-
 		JSONObject root = JSONObject.fromObject(result).optJSONObject("jd_union_open_order_query_response");
 		if (root.optInt("code") == 0) {
 			boolean hasMore = root.optBoolean("hasMore");
 			root = JSONObject.fromObject(root.optString("result"));
-			if (root.optInt("code") == 200) {
+			if (root.optInt("code") == 200&&root.optJSONArray("data")!=null) {
+				
 				String date = root.optJSONArray("data").toString();
 				Type typeToken = new TypeToken<List<JDOrder>>() {
 				}.getType();

--
Gitblit v1.8.0